A bolt pattern refers to the arrangement of the bolt holes on your vehicle's wheels. It is crucial to match the bolt pattern of your new wheels with your vehicle's specifications to ensure a proper fit. This means that the number of bolt holes and their spacing need to be compatible. The "6x127" bolt pattern means the wheel has 6 lug holes arranged in a 127 millimeter circle (also known as 6x5"). This pattern is common on many GM, Isuzu, and select older SUVs and trucks.
The 6x127 bolt pattern converts to approximately 6x5 inches. To convert millimeters to inches, divide by 25.4. Always double-check bolt spacing and hub bore when choosing 6x127 wheels.

Popular vehicles include: Chevrolet TrailBlazer (2002-2009), GMC Envoy (2002-2009), Buick Rainier (2004-2007), Isuzu Ascender (2003-2008), Oldsmobile Bravada (2002-2004), Saab 9-7X (2005-2009), and others depending on trim level and production year.
